What are 2 BHK, 3 BHK, and 4 BHK?
2 BHK, 3 BHK, and 4 BHK refer to the number of bedrooms, halls, and kitchens in a residential flat or apartment.
- 2 BHK includes two bedrooms, a hall, and a kitchen. It is suited for small families, young professionals, and individuals.
- 3 BHK includes three bedrooms, a hall, and a kitchen. It is suitable for medium-sized families or people who want an extra room for guests, a home office, or other needs.
- 4 BHK includes four bedrooms, a hall, and a kitchen. It is intended for larger families or people who prefer additional space.
Factors to consider before choosing: A Guide to Choosing the Right Flat
Family size: One of the most significant aspects is the size of the family. A two-bedroom flat is suitable for a small family or a couple. However, a 3 or 4 BHK is a preferable option for a large family or any individual who needs additional space.
Budget: It is one of the most significant factors to consider while making a decision. A 2 BHK flat is often more economical. On the other hand, 3 and 4 BHK houses are more expensive but offer greater space and amenities.
Future needs: If you anticipate the need for additional space in the near future, investing in a 3 or 4 BHK may save you the hassle of moving later.
Location and Amenities: Choosing a property in well-connected with easy access to important amenities such as schools, hospitals, and markets provides better value. Furthermore, larger apartments are sometimes part of luxury developments with greater amenities such as gyms, swimming pools, and clubhouses.
Resale Value: Because of their size and popularity, 2 and 3 BHK flats typically have a high resale value, although 4 BHK flats can command even larger returns due to their luxury and space. Additionally, Choosing a property in a developing region with adequate infrastructure and connections can greatly increase its resale value.
